Transaction 648701304035de956d5c49decbcbf76f3a9a59c33bcb26d454161c49678fb4ca
1 Input
1 Output
-
648701304035de956d5c49decbcbf76f3a9a59c33bcb26d454161c49678fb4ca:0
- value
- 1340
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d6749d8d1005b62be85235591c2bcc321d85db993c9e7c8c1483ed63fe4e3599
- address
- bc1p6e6fmrgsqkmzh6zjx4v3c27vxgwctkue8j08erq5s0kk8ljwxkvsxap83m